However, last week Shiller hinted that recent ...Also known as a real estate bubble, a housing bubble occurs when home prices rise at a rapid rate to a level of instability. Housing bubbles generally begin when there is a shortage of inventory and an increase in demand in a market. As the prices start rising, speculation begins to take effect. A housing bubble is characterized by a period of rapidly rising demand for housing and an increase in home prices. When a housing bubble bursts, home values can drop, homeowners can lose equity, and, in a worst-case scenario, a recession can occur. "The Denver Housing Authority has approved the purchase of the 194-unit Best Western Central Park hotel located at 4595 Quebec Street. The hotel will be used for permanent supportive housing. The property will be purchased for $25.95 million using approximately $11 million from the DHA Delivers for Denver bond funds.
